CONFIGURING PNIC TO PERFORM FLOW PROCESSING OFFLOAD USING VIRTUAL PORT IDENTIFIERS
Abstract:
Some embodiments of the invention provide a method for configuring a physical network card or physical network controller (pNIC) to provide flow processing offload (FPO) for a host computer connected to the pNIC. The host computers host a set of compute nodes in a virtual network. The set of compute nodes are each associated with a set of interfaces that are each assigned a locally-unique virtual port identifier (VPID) by a flow processing and action generator. The pNIC includes a set of interfaces that are assigned physical port identifiers (PPIDs) by the pNIC. The method includes providing the pNIC with a set of mappings between VPIDs and PPIDs. The method also includes sending updates to the mappings as compute nodes migrate, connect to different interfaces of the pNIC, are assigned different VPIDs, etc. In some embodiments, the flow processing and action generator executes on processing units of the host computer, while in other embodiments, the flow processing and action generator executes on a set of processing units of a pNIC that includes flow processing hardware and a set of programmable processing units.
